Answered by
4
He need a total of 104 poles.
• Given data :
The fence is square in shape.
Number of poles in the one side of fence = 27
• Now, in the two parallel sides of the fence the total number of poles is
= 27×2
= 54 poles
• Now,in the other two parallel sides of the fence the total number pole will be 4 less than the total number of the poles in other two parallel sides, because the 4 poles in the 4 corner overlap each other in the edge of two two consecutive sides.
• So,the number of poles in the other two sides
= 54 - 4
= 50 poles
• Total number of poles = 50+54 = 104 poles (answer)
